The Ming Zhou Palace was discovered in the spring of 1981.

At that time, when the Kaifeng City Gardening Department was cleaning the mud at the bottom of Pan Lake in front of Longting, they accidentally discovered some remains of the Song Dynasty Palace and the Ming and Zhou Dynasty Palaces, thus opening the curtain on the archeology of the Ming and Zhou Dynasty Palace ruins.

A series of excavations have shown that the ground in the Forbidden City is mostly paved with blue bricks, and some important locations such as the foundations and doors are paved with bluestone strips. The distance between the paved ground and the lake bottom is about 1.5 to 2 meters.

During the entire excavation process, a total of 12 house foundations, 2 flower beds, and 2 drainage ditches were unearthed. The house foundations unearthed were all high platform buildings, and some of the platform foundations were 1.6 meters higher than the ground at that time. From this, we can imagine that those days

The buildings in the Forbidden City are so tall.

North wall of the Golden Palace: In 1986, excavation results by cultural relics and archaeologists in Kaifeng City in the parking lot of the automobile company in Kaifeng City showed that the north wall of the Golden Palace was stacked under the Ming and Xiao walls and on top of the north wall of the inner city of the Song Dynasty.

, 4.15 meters to 4.45 meters above the surface, 0.3 meters thick.

The wall is made of rammed gray-brown soil, and the ramming nests of the rammed layer are not very obvious. The bottom of the wall is paved with a layer of bricks about 5 cm thick, and the bricks are all residual blue bricks.

In May 1996, cultural relics and archaeologists in Kaifeng City, in cooperation with the infrastructure construction process, discovered the Wumen ruins near Xinjiekou on the east-west street of Kaifeng City today.

Drilling results show that the Wumen ruins are overlaid under the Meridian Gate ruins, the south gate of the Xiaoqiang Palace of the Ming and Zhou Dynasties, at a depth of about 6.3 meters from the surface, and at the same time, they are overlaid under the south gate of the Song Dynasty Palace, which is 8.3 meters deep from the surface.
